In November 2025, someone on Telegram quietly uploaded a stealer log labeled Mansory 5, and inside it sat 962,245 records worth of stolen logins. This is exactly how a huge chunk of today's credential leaks start now, not with a dramatic corporate hack, but with malware quietly grabbing whatever passwords a victim's browser had saved.


Why This Is Dangerous

Stealer logs are dangerous because the data inside them is fresh and usually still works. Unlike an old database dump that companies have long since forced password resets on, a log like this one can contain credentials that people are using right now, the day you recieve this information could be the same day someone tries to log into your accounts with it.

Why This Matters

Because the passwords in Mansory 5 were captured in plaintext, wich means there is no encryption standing between an attacker and your actual password, this leak is a near-instant onramp to account takeover for anyone caught up in it. If you reuse a password across multiple sites, one exposed login can open several doors at once.


How Stealer Log Breaches Work

A stealer log comes from malware that infects a device, often through a cracked game, a fake software installer, or a malicious email attachment. Once running, it silently copies saved passwords, browser cookies, and autofill data, then bundles it all into a file and sends it back to whoever controls the malware. That file, full of real usernames, passwords, and the exact websites they belong to, is what eventually gets uploaded and traded on Telegram channels like the one behind this leak.
